Take on the trail and win, with the Analog’s perfectly balanced handling and components
A hardtail is a versatile beast, so it helps to have the right kit to get the most out of that versatility. With the Analog we started by choosing Sram’s Eagle 1×12 transmission. With its huge range, ease of use and reliable performance, it’s the go-to for many keen riders. Paired with powerful hydraulic disc brakes and a smooth RockShox suspension fork, it puts you firmly in control. Grippy 2.25in tyres, perfect sizing from our SizeSplit system and the option of a future dropper post upgrade complete the package.

| Frame Description | The Analog's sleek looks are thanks to its smooth-welded head tube and seat tube junctions. It incorporates a threaded bottom bracket and internal cable routing for long-lasting service and simple maintenance. There's even a flat disc mount that integrates seamlessly with our kickstand mount, and integrated mounting points for ACID mudguards and carrier. Updated geometry includes a lower top tube and tapered head tube for more confident handling, cables run internally for reduced maintenance, and there's plenty of room to run wide, grippy and comfortable 2.25in tyres. Our SizeSplit system has an expanded range too, so however tall you are there'll be an Analog that fits perfectly. And, as your skills increase, there's scope to fit a dropper post upgrade. |
